Complimentary Airport Club Access1 Enjoy complimentary access for you and up to two guests to American Airlines Admirals Club? lounges, Delta Sky Club? lounges and US Airways? clubs--an average savings of $450 per club. Plus, enjoy unlimited access to the Airspace LoungeTM in Concourse D at the Baltimore Washington International Airport, regardless of which airline you're flying.2

Priority PassTM Select Program3 With a complimentary Priority Pass Select membership, you may access over 600 airport lounges worldwide regardless of which airline you are flying, what class you are traveling in or whether or not you belong to an airline lounge program--a retail value of $399. Simply show your Priority Pass Select card to gain entry; travel companions may enter for a fee, automatically charged to your Corporate Platinum Card.

Global Entry Membership4 This U.S. Customs and Border Protection program allows participants to enter the United States by using automated kiosks located at select airports--so there's no need to wait in the passport line. When you use your Corporate Platinum Card to apply for a Global Entry membership, the application fee is reimbursed to you. U.S. passport holders can apply at

SERVICE Concierge Services7 Access a team of consultants who are available 24/7 to support you, from finding a business gift to providing dining suggestions and reservations.

INSURANCE & PROTECTION Business Travel Accident Insurance8 Travel with confidence knowing you're protected on all your business trips with up to $500,000 door-to-door coverage in accidental death and dismemberment insurance.

Premium Global Assist? Hotline9 The Corporate Platinum Card can make you feel more secure when you're far away. Whenever you're more than 100 miles from home and you need access to medical, legal, financial and other emergency assistance, you can get help 24/7. We can also help you with prescription replacements, emergency hotel check-ins and cash access, lost luggage and passports, and emergency Card replacement.

4Global Entry: Global Entry is a U.S. government program. American Express has no control over the application and/or approval process, and does not have access to any information provided to the government by the Corporate Platinum Card member. American Express has no liability regarding the Global Entry program. If you need more information regarding the application and/or approval process, as well as the full terms and conditions of this program, please go to . The benefit is available to Corporate Platinum Card members only. To receive a $100 statement credit, the Corporate Platinum Card member must complete the Global Entry application and pay for the fee with a valid Corporate Platinum Card. If approved, membership into the Global Entry program is valid for 5 years without additional charges and subject to the Global Entry program's terms and conditions. The $100 application fee must be paid regardless of the decision by U.S. Customs and Border Protection and is required to process the application. Membership is per person, and a separate application must be completed for each individual. Please allow 6-8 weeks after the qualifying Global Entry transaction is charged to your Corporate Platinum Card account for statement credit to be posted to the account. The Corporate Platinum Card member is responsible for payment of all charges until the statement credit posts to the respective account. To be eligible for this benefit, the respective Corporate Platinum Card account must be active and in good standing at the time of statement credit fulfillment.
